Focus
There are two methods to focus
the camera:
a. To auto focus push the FOCUS
button on the side of the camera.
b. The second method is manual focus.
The user needs to push the focus
select button to MANUAL. This is
the same button you would push to
select auto focus. On the LCD
screen manual focus is represented
by an icon of a hand with a "F"
inside it (See image).
Adjust the focus ring until the shot
comes into focus and then record.
Note: it is suggested that auto focus be used
until the user becomes comfortable with
manual focus option.
II. Recording
When recording video you can view the shot through the LCD screen or through the
viewfinder. The concept of the camera is to point and record. The camera needs to be in the
CAMERA mode to record video.
To Record
a. Simply aim the camera and press the
record button (See image).
